We Three....

In her personal quarters aboard The Maleficum Darth Venefica studied the flimsy, aged tome she found in the late Mr. Poy's collection chamber, where she obtained the holocron she sought, religiously. The tome itself was not important, but the information it contained was priceless. Whether it was truth or a quest for fools, she could not ignore the possibilities that such an holocron existed. Tucking the tome away in a lock box, she pushed away from her desk, stood up, and headed to the bridge.
"Captain Virter.....a word."
Exiting the bridge with Captain Virter on her heels, she led the man down a corridor.
"Your feelings about my personal quests have been historically noted....but this quest is important to me. I would like for you, personally, to join me."
"Mi'lady, I would be honoured to accompany you this round. Where are we headed?"
"We are heading to Lowick."
"I'll make the preparations, Mi'lady."
The two parted ways, the Captain heading back to the bridge and Darth Venefica to her quarters.
 
The landing party made it planet side, debarked from the shuttle, and waited until the last member of one company of the Shadows of the Black Rose fell into line. The group, as told to them at the briefing, would be marching through the forests of Lowick; to the location the tome said the holocron could be found.
"Captain.....you will lead the girls."
Without waiting for a reply, the Sith began trouncing through the forest, taking in the sights and listening for danger. There wasn't any 'apex' predators that hunted the forests, but it was known that pirates used the planet's forests as a means to hide and regroup from the prying government's eyes. They didn't pose a threat to a force like the witch brought, however obtaining the holocron outweighed the risk of taking chances.
After some hours of marching, it came to understanding the girls needed to rest, despite their training.
"We camp for the night.....and take up in the early dawn of light."
